Histórico da Página
01. DADOS GERAIS
Linha de Produto: | Virtual Age |
---|---|
Segmento: | Moda |
Módulo: | Industrial |
Função: | Permitir incluir mais de um grupo em O.P. com categoria de tecelagem malha. |
Ticket: | 7422799 |
Requisito/Story/Issue (informe o requisito relacionado) : | DVAIND-4641 |
02. SITUAÇÃO/REQUISITO
Atualmente, ao utilizar mais de um grupo nas O.Ps. de tecelagem o sistema abre a inclusão de lote ao salvar(F3) a primeira vez, ou seja, quando é incluído o primeiro produto, informada a quantidade, ao salvar é chamada a rotina PCPFP198, porém quando é incluído o segundo produto, ao realizar a ação salvar(F3) não é aberto o PCPFP198 novamente.
03. SOLUÇÃO
Nas O.Ps. cuja categoria escolhida for do tipo "Tecelagem malha", ao gravar uma O.P. que tenha 2 ou mais produtos de grupos diferentes, deverá abrir o componente PCPFP198 separadamente para cada um dos grupos de produto.
Ao incluir um novo produto em uma O.P. que já esteja previamente gravada, deverá ser feita a chamada do componente PCPFP198, com os novos itens carregados, para que sejam montadas as listas de item de lote para esses novos itens da O.P..
Totvs custom tabs box | ||||
---|---|---|---|---|
| ||||
Imagem 1 - Categoria 999 configurada com o tipo O.P. "Tecelagem malha". Imagem 2 - A categoria 999 foi configurada no parâmetro DS_LST_CATEG_OP_LOTE. Imagem 3 - Ao cadastrar a O.P. 76 com a categoria 999 foi chamado o componente PCPFP198 para que o usuário informe a quantidade de itens de lote que deseja gerar para o item da O.P., este processo já existia. Imagem 4 - Ao incluir um novo item à O.P. que já estava gravada foi realizada a chamada do componente PCPFP198 para que sejam gravados os itens de lote para o novo item da O.P., ao gravar uma nova O.P. com grupos diferentes deverá abrir o componente PCPFP198 separadamente para cada um dos grupos de produto acabado. |
Templatedocumentos |
---|
HTML |
---|
<style> div.theme-default .ia-splitter #main { margin-left: 0px; } .ia-fixed-sidebar, .ia-splitter-left { display: none; } #main { padding-left: 10px; padding-right: 10px; overflow-x: hidden; } .aui-header-primary .aui-nav, .aui-page-panel { margin-left: 0px !important; } .aui-header-primary .aui-nav { margin-left: 0px !important; } .aui-tabs.horizontal-tabs>.tabs-menu>.menu-item.active-tab a::after { background: #FF9900; !important } .menu-item.active-tab { border-bottom: none !important; } </style> |